[제품종류] IEC1000
[개발환경] Visual Studio 2008 VB
=============== 질 문 ===============strReceive = SmartX.SmartTCPClient.ConvertByteToASCII(datas)에서
"ConvertByteToASCII(datas)는 SmartX.SmartTCPClient의 멤버가 아닙니다" 라고 에러가 뜹니다
원인이 뭘까요>
=============== 답 변 ===============
안녕하세요
해당 메서드는 SmartX Framework 3.0.0 버전 이후로 메서드명이 변경되었습니다.
(업로드일 : 2017-12-14)
[내용] SmartSerialPort, SmartTCPMultiServer, SmartTcpClient 함수명 변경
- 기존 ConvertByteToASCII()를 ConvertAsciiByteToString()로 변경
- 기존 ConvertByteToUnicode()를 ConvertUnicodeByteToString()로 변경
[사용법]
strReceive = SmartX.SmartTCPClient.ConvertAsciiByteToString(datas)
SmartTCPClient예제에서 에러가 발생하신다는 걸로 보아
PC에 설치된 SmartX Framework 버전은3.0.0 이후 버전이지만,
갖고 계신 예제가 3.0.0 이전 버전인 것 같습니다.
따라서 [자료실-SmartX Framework 관련-6. SmartX Framework 예제파일]에서
사용하시는 제품과 언어에 맞는 예제를 다시 다운받아 테스트해 주시기 바랍니다.
다른 문의사항은 전화 070-7094-5001(H/W담당자), 070-7094-5002(S/W담당자)로 연락바랍니다
감사합니다.